859536-33-7,859538-76-4,85954-11-6,85955-36-8,817177-74-5,817181-75-2 Supplier | CMSTRADE.CN
CMO CDMO service. CMSTRADE.CN supply 859536-33-7,859538-76-4,85954-11-6,85955-36-8,817177-74-5,817181-75-2 and related compounds.
859538-76-4
859536-33-7
85954-11-6
817177-74-5
85955-36-8
817181-75-2